Last meeting of the Interim Government

The Interim Government or provisional government was established on 2nd September 1946. It was tasked to oversee the transition to independence.

The last meeting of the Interim Government took place despite many important matters not having been properly addressed. Many of the governments tasks were deferred to commissions and councils. This highlighted the chaotic and rushed nature of the transfer of power.
